Introduction

In the ever-evolving landscape of international relations, security and economic ties stand as crucial pillars for fostering stability and growth. Recently, the Philippines (PH) and Laos reaffirmed their commitment to these vital connections during a bilateral meeting, signaling a strengthened partnership aimed at mutual benefit and regional prosperity. The discussions between the Philippines and Laos centered on enhancing collaboration in various sectors, including defense, trade, investment, and tourism. By solidifying these ties, both countries aim to create a more secure and prosperous future for their citizens. The commitment to strengthening security cooperation reflects a shared understanding of the need to address transnational threats such as terrorism, drug trafficking, and cybercrime. Through joint training exercises, information sharing, and coordinated border patrols, the Philippines and Laos can enhance their collective capacity to safeguard their respective territories and contribute to regional stability. Furthermore, the emphasis on economic collaboration highlights the potential for increased trade and investment flows between the two countries. By reducing trade barriers, streamlining customs procedures, and promoting investment opportunities, the Philippines and Laos can unlock new avenues for economic growth and job creation. The development of infrastructure projects, such as roads, bridges, and ports, will also play a crucial role in facilitating trade and connectivity. The collaboration on infrastructure development is particularly crucial for Laos. As a landlocked country, access to efficient transportation networks is essential for its economic growth. Joint projects with the Philippines in areas such as roads, bridges, and ports can improve connectivity and facilitate trade with neighboring countries. This can significantly reduce transportation costs and improve the competitiveness of Lao products in the global market. It's like building a bridge to the world!
